Thai Food Recipe: Pad No Mai Sai Pla Muek (Spicy Bamboo and Squid Stir-Fried)

Prepare:

1 cup cooked squid
2 cup sliced bamboo
2 tbsp. sliced kaffir lime leaves
1/2 cup sweet basil
1 tbsp. pad ped paste
1 tbsp. soy sauce
1/2 tbsp. fish sauce
1 tbsp. oyster sauce
1 tbsp. olive oil
1/2 cup water
1 tbsp. minced garlic

 

Cooking Instructions:

1. I have pad ped paste from last time i cook the food called Ho Mok Talay.

The paste is made by grounding 2 lemongrass (sliced), 2 pieces galangal (cut finely), 2 red onions, 1 clove garlic, 2 tsp. shrimp paste, 1 tsp. kaffir lime skin (sliced), and 5 dried red chili peppers together

2. Heat the pan and put olive oil. Fry the garlic until it smells good and then add paste. Stir fry about 20 seconds.

3. Put squid and bamboo. Add fish sauce, soy sauce, oyster sauce and 2 tbsp. of water.

4. Mix everything well. Add sweet basil. Mix it again and then turn off the fire.

5. Serve with hot jasmine rice.
